Management Commentary
During the public earnings call held following the release of the previous quarter results, AESI’s leadership team framed the quarterly loss as a product of targeted short-term investments in operational capacity, alongside temporary demand softness across key customer segments. Per public remarks from the call, management noted that the bulk of the quarterly EPS deviation from break-even was tied to non-recurring costs associated with upgrades to its primary production facilities, which are designed to reduce long-term unit operating costs and expand capacity for higher-margin specialty proppant products. Leadership also emphasized that it had implemented targeted cost-reduction measures across non-core operational functions over the course of the quarter to offset near-term revenue pressures, including cuts to discretionary spending and adjustments to staffing levels at underutilized sites. The team also noted that it had maintained access to sufficient liquidity to cover ongoing operational and capital expenditure needs through the current market cycle.

Forward Guidance
Atlas Energy did not share specific quantitative forward guidance for upcoming operating periods as part of its the previous quarter earnings release, in line with its recent disclosure practices amid ongoing market volatility. Management noted that its near-term strategic priorities will remain focused on preserving liquidity, maintaining a strong balance sheet, and completing the ongoing facility upgrade projects on schedule. The team also highlighted that there is potential for improved demand trends later in the year if upstream oil and gas operators raise their capital spending budgets in response to sustained commodity price strength, though they cautioned that market conditions remain highly uncertain and dependent on macroeconomic factors outside of the firm’s control. AESI also noted that it intends to provide additional operational updates alongside its full regulatory filing for the quarter in the coming weeks.

Market Reaction
Following the release of the the previous quarter results, AESI saw normal trading activity in its first session post-announcement, with price moves broadly in line with the performance of the broader energy services index on the same day. Analysts covering the stock have noted that the reported EPS figure was roughly in line with consensus estimates, so the results did not trigger a major unanticipated market reaction. Some research teams have flagged the lack of disclosed revenue data as a point of uncertainty that may lead to higher-than-usual volatility in AESI’s share price in the coming weeks, until additional details are released in the company’s official regulatory filing. Broader market sentiment toward energy services stocks has been mixed in recent weeks, as investors weigh the potential for slower near-term upstream spending against the possibility of sustained commodity price support for longer-term activity levels.
